Introduction to Weighted Vest Workouts

Understanding the concept of weighted vest workouts

Weighted vest workouts harness a timeless and proven method to amplify the intensity and efficacy of exercise regimens. The premise hinges on a straightforward yet potent strategy – elevate the body’s workload by incorporating additional weight during exercises, leading to heightened resistance and greater caloric expenditure. A weighted vest is a strategic piece of equipment that uniformly apportions this extra weight across the torso, intensifying any undertaken activity. This approach significantly augments the resistance encountered during bodyweight exercises and cardiovascular endeavors, rendering them more strenuous and thus more productive.

Tracing back to historical precedents, warriors and competitive athletes have consistently engaged in added weight training to bolster their physical prowess and stamina. Modern-day fitness employs a similar doctrine, embedding the use of weighted vests into workout routines. The scientific rationale aligning with this practice is elementary; an added weight compels your muscles to combat increased resistance. Such incremental resistance can amplify workout intensity, catalyze a more substantial calorie burn, fortify cardiovascular health, and advance muscle strength along with endurance. From executing push-ups and squats to embarking on vigorous walks, the addition of a weighted vest can propel your fitness quest to unprecedented heights.

Safety precautions and tips

Embarking on a weighted vest workout regimen demands a tactical approach to safety. Starting with a lighter weight allows your body to adapt to the added resistance, thereby preventing unnecessary strain on your muscles and joints. It is essential to scale up the load progressively in line with your strength and endurance gains.

Ensuring the vest’s fit is akin to suiting up for a mission – it must be precise to avoid any hindrance or injury. A snug, secure fit ensures stability and freedom of movement, and prevents the vest from bouncing, which could throw off your balance and increase the risk of injury.

Listen to your body’s intelligence – it’s your built-in early warning system. Discomfort or pain signals the need for a tactical pause. Rest isn’t just a lapse in action; it’s a strategic part of your training where recovery and strengthening occur.

Lastly, consider enlisting the expertise of a fitness tactician – a certified trainer. They can advise on the correct form and safe exercise execution. By following these guidelines, you can safely harness the potential of weighted vest workouts to augment your physical preparedness.

Understanding vest weights

Weighted vests are offered in a gamut of weights, allowing you to tailor your loadout to match your operational needs or training objectives. The spectrum typically ranges from a nimble 5 pounds up to a hefty 50 pounds or more, ensuring you have the versatility to escalate or de-escalate the weight as the mission or workout dictates.

While some vests come with a predefined weight, others boast modular capabilities, letting you adjust the weight by adding or removing plates or sandbags to meet the specifications of your task. This adjustability factor is pivotal for a dynamic workout regime or for adapting to the endurance levels required on different days or in different scenarios.

For the tactical athlete, loading up with more weight can mirror the stress of gear-laden operations, amplifying strength conditioning. Conversely, a lighter adaptation suits cardiovascular-focused drills, enhancing agility and stamina without overburdening the operative. As your physical prowess escalates, these adaptable vests prove their worth, offering scalability that parallels your advancing capabilities.

Basic exercises to begin with

When venturing into the realm of weighted vest workouts, initiate your regimen with straightforward activities such as walking or jogging. This foundational step allows for acclimation to the vest’s presence and its supplementary weight, mitigating undue strain on your physique. As you acclimate and gain comfort, graduate to rudimentary bodyweight exercises like squats and push-ups. These fundamental drills, when amplified by the weighted vest, bolster strength and endurance more significantly. Commence with a modest number of sets for each maneuver, ensuring your technique remains precise and correct. With the progression of strength and stamina, you can amplify the set or repetition count, or perhaps tackle more intricate exercises. It’s critical to escalate the rigor of your workouts progressively to avert burnout or injury. Embark slowly, heed your body’s signals, and advance at a cadence that aligns with your personal comfort and capacity.

Avoiding common mistakes

While elevating your training with a weighted vest, beware of a few critical missteps. Foregoing a proper warm-up or cool-down is a tactical error in any regimen. Activating your muscles with light cardio and dynamic stretches preps them for the mission ahead, and a thorough cool-down brings them safely back to base, reducing the risk of injury and accelerating recovery.

In the thick of a weighted workout, sweat loss can compromise your effectiveness. Stay tactical about your hydration game plan—pre-load with water, maintain your fluid intake, and replenish after deployment.

The cornerstone of mission success is proper form and technique. Subpar execution can jeopardize the mission’s objectives and risk collateral damage—in this case, potential injury. Fine-tune each movement as if it’s a skill to be mastered. 

Recovery and Maintenance

Importance of rest and recovery

Your mission readiness hinges on more than just the training you endure; it’s also about the strategic downtime you allow your body for maintenance and recovery. Rest days should be as much a part of your routine as your workouts. After pushing your limits with a weighted vest, your muscle fibers need time to repair the micro-tears from intensive training. It’s this rebuilding stage that fortifies your muscles, making them stronger for your next engagement.

A relentless schedule without adequate downtime leads to a dangerous territory known as overtraining. The signs are clear: a drop in your performance, the rise of potential injuries, and a feeling of unshakable weariness. It’s essential to respect what your body tells you; if fatigue or soreness sets in, it’s your cue to stand down and recuperate.

Beyond scheduled rest days, never underestimate the battle-winning impact of sleep on muscle recovery. As you enter the quiet hours of the night, your body commences a critical operation – producing growth hormone. This natural agent plays a pivotal role in muscle repair and building. Secure a minimum of 7-9 hours of sleep each night and consider it an investment in your tactical edge, ensuring that growth and recovery keep pace with your operational demands.

Maintaining your weighted vest

Just like any other piece of fitness equipment, your weighted vest requires regular maintenance to keep it in top combat-ready condition. Be vigilant and regularly inspect your vest for any indications of wear and tear, such as fraying straps or compromised weight compartments. Should you detect any form of damage, it’s pivotal to address the issue with repairs, or if necessary, replace the vest altogether to maintain operational safety and efficiency.

Cleaning your vest is likewise integral to extending its service life and retaining its professional appearance. Adhere strictly to the manufacturer’s instructions when cleaning your gear. This typically means undertaking a conservative approach: spot cleaning with a damp cloth, a mild cleaning agent, and ensuring adequate air drying. By instituting a regular maintenance routine, you’re securing that your weighted vest continues to be an indispensable asset in your fitness arsenal for countless missions ahead.
